Description of problem: ======================= rh-access-plugin search button grayed-out after one search.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): ============================================================= redhat-access-plugin-openstack-1.2.0-4.el6ost.noarch How reproducible: ================= 3/3 Steps to Reproduce: =================== 1. Browse to: http://<FQDN>/dashboard/redhat_access_plugin_openstack/ 2. Login to Red Hat Customer Portal. 3. write any text in the search box and press search. Actual results: =============== The search button grayed-out. Expected results: ================= The search button keep functioning in case the user want to perform another search. Additional Info: ================ Refresh the page as a workaround.
Horizon version it was discovered with: python-django-horizon-2013.2-0.13b3.el6ost.noarch
